Listing Information |
---|
Automobile: 1999 Lincoln Towncar Executive Series with 84k miles
Crocks: 1 gal. Decorated D.H. Henkel & Grim Stonyman, 1 gal. S. Bell & Son Strasburg, 1 gal. Strasburg, 3 gal. Unmarked, many unmarked crocks all sizes.
N.H. Clark Dairy quart milk bottle
Flour bags & misc. memorabilia: 1936 Willow Grove calendar, Willow Grove Milling Company Lilly White, Globe, & Golden Eagle cloth flour bags, Willow Grove Mills Meadow Lark, Sweet biscuit, Dutch Girl, Snow Flake, Gold Seal flour bags misc. sizes, Willow Grove corn meal bags, Page Milling Company Early morn buckwheat flour, Besgrade whole wheat graham flour, and more. US military mess kits and canteen, Underwood Noiseless typewriter, Philco Stereophonic, National Family Scale, Singer sewing machine and table, Lance display case, and much more.
Mantle & Wall Clocks: Atkins & Downs mantle clock with Clark residence painted on front, Improved Clocks by R& H Atkins Bristol Conn., Vintage Banjo clock, Royal Bonn painted porcelain clock made in Germany, and many more. Pictures / oil paintings: J H Holt, Queena Stovall (Herefords in the Snow Feb. 1963 & Hillside Pastures Nov. 1958), G.W. Painter, J. Brumback, Equestrian Portrait of Prince Balthasar Charles oil paintings and more, Gary Saylor prints ( Fort Stover & Valley Barn), Tim Huffman drawings. Many paintings and drawings of the Willow Grove Mill and of the Clark residences.
Glassware & Misc: Misc. Carnival glass, green & pink depression glass, Iris bowls, Victorian Cone Pattern sugar, salt & pepper shakers, Occupied Japan, Royal Worcester porcelain made in England, Jean Luce France, Thomas from Bavaria, several butter molds and prints, Wedgewood blue jasperware, Striped stoneware farm bowls, tons of pitchers, glasses and plates, China set, what nots, and much more.
Furniture & Misc: Beautiful post office box from Stanley Post Office, Hoosier Cabinet, Antique hand crank wall phone, Plantation desk, farm tables, 6 leg drop leaf table, marble top tables & cabinets, spool leg tables, hand painted Hurricane lamps, oak armoire, oak dresser w/ mirror, bedroom set, cedar blanket chest, spool chest, secretary, very old handmade hutch, Clore style chairs, rockers, child rockers, porch swing, porch rocker, bench, Gazebo, iron furniture, concrete planters & yard ornaments, Willow Grove Farm sign and much more.
